Planning your app
1. Who will use your app? (Who is your app's target user?)
The app's target users will be people who know or want to learn how to crochet.
2. What need or problem will your app solve? How do you know this is really a need for your target user? How does the target user currently deal with the problem?
My app will essentially provide a registry of common crochet techniques. I have this problem where I take long breaks between projects that I forget how to make things like magic circles. So I want to create a registry of fundamentals that include websites or videos that I think explain the techniques pretty well. Currently the target users are probably just Googling the techniques which does return answers but there so many resources and it can be quite overwhelming. So this will be a one-stop for the 'best' resources for users to access.
3. How will your app's design meet the need you have identified?
I will try to return video links as well as written instructions so that it can help both visually and in written format. I will import the written instructions from a collection of websites, depending on which provides a better one. Videos are quite easy for selection, I will include links for those with subtitles and are short in length so the users can quickly get their answers isntead of having to skip videos etc.
